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Broad-muzzled Bat | Pallas's squirrel, Red-bellied tree squirrel |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(동물) | Animalia (동물)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(척삭동물) | Chordata (척삭동물) |
| Class same | Mammalia (포유류) | Mammalia (포유류) |
| Order | Chiroptera (박쥐) | Rodentia (설치류) |
| Family | Vespertilionidae | Sciuridae (Squirrels) |
| Genus | Submyotodon | Callosciurus |
| Species | Submyotodon latirostris | Callosciurus erythraeus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Broad-muzzled Bat and Pallas's squirrel, Red-bellied tree squirrel share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(포유류)
